Our speaker

We're honoured that Major General Nick Perry, DSO, MBE will be speaking at the event.

Nick Perry has served in the British Army for 28 years. He joined in 1996 and spent the bulk of the next eight years as a tank commander. Having trained in Germany, Canada, Singapore, Poland and the US, he deployed on Operations to Bosnia in 1997 and Kosovo in 1999 where he was the Close Reconnaissance Troop leader for the initial operation. He spent much of the following ten years deployed to Iraq, Afghanistan and the broader Middle East.

From 2014 to 2016, he served as the Military Assistant and Private Secretary to the Prime Minister, working for both David Cameron and Theresa May. In 2017, he took command of the UK’s high readiness Air Manoeuvre formation, 16 Air Assault Brigade. A tour as Head of the Joint Plans Capability area within Finance and Military Capability in MOD Main Building then followed. In March 2021 he took up the role of Assistant Chief of the General Staff. 

His current role, which he began last summer, sees him in command of high readiness soldiers, sailors and aviators on operations globally.
